RICS Level 3 Home Surveys

If you are considering purchasing an older or listed property, one of non-traditional construction, a building in disrepair or a property that has been significantly altered or for which major works are planned, a Level 3 Home Survey is recommended.

We will carry out a comprehensive inspection and provide you with an easy-to-read report, including photographs and insurance rebuild costs. We will also follow this up with a telephone conversation, in which we will explain the report and any significant issues identified.

You can expect your report within 4 days of our visit and costed repair options are available for an additional fee.

RICS Level 2 Home Surveys

Based on a traffic light system, this easy-to-read report format is recommended for conventional properties constructed after 1900.

 

The Level 2 Home Survey is a reduced building survey and provides a general inspection of the property, valuation and insurance rebuild costs along with post-survey telephone conversation explaining our findings and any significant issues identified.


You can expect your report within 4 days of our visit.

Commercial Surveys/Schedule of Condition

If you are looking to purchase a commercial property or sign or renew a commercial lease, a building survey is recommended before you invest your money. This includes a thorough inspection of the building with fully costed repairs.

 

A schedule of condition is recommended if you are about to sign a new lease. This can be attached to the lease to limit your future repair liabilities, which could save you thousands. A schedule of condition, which contains numerous photographs, may be commissioned by a lessee at the start of a lease or by the current owner to ensure the property is returned in the same condition at the end of the lease.
